With the Nov desktop update I have modified my reports with the horizontal filters and the visual interactions. Since then I observe a strange behaviour when reviewing the reports with the service - very often when one opens a report the circles in the visuals keep spinning as if data is still filtered/visualized. Some of the users wait patiently the circles to stop spinning (i.e. data to be loaded/filtered). However this does not happen. One has to press some of the filters in order to see that data are actually loaded and you don't need to wait anymore.
The data volume is not that big and I don't believe this to be a performance issue
Does anybody experience the same problem?
